2. Series Solutions (around ordinary point)

Solve the following ODEs by power series (around x0 ) method.


1. y 00 + 4y = 0, around x0 = 0.
2. y 00 − 9y = 0, around x0 = 0.
3. y 00 − xy 0 − y = 0, around x0 = 1.
4. (1 − x)y 00 + y = 0, around x0 = 0.
5. (2 + x2 )y 00 − xy 0 + 4y = 0, around x0 = 0.
6. xy 00 + y 0 + xy = 0, around x0 = 1.

3. The Bessel’s Equation

1. Prove that
J−p (x) = (−1)p Jp (x), p ∈ N.

2. Prove the following relation

(a) (xp Jp (x))0 = xp Jp−1 (x)

(b) (x−p Jp (x))0 = −x−p Jp+1 (x)


2p
(c) Jp+1 (x) + Jp−1 (x) = x p
J (x)

(d) Jp+1 (x) − Jp−1 (x) = 2Jp (x)0

3. When n is an integer show that (i) Jn (x) is an even function if n is


even, (ii) Jn (x) is an odd function if n is odd.

4. Show that between any two consecutive positive zeros of Jn (x) there is
precisely one zero of Jn+1 (x) and one zero of Jn−1 (x).
